Misty Double Glazing Repairs

Misted double glazing is a frequent issue that can be costly to fix. It is usually caused by a leak in the seal that allows moisture to penetrate and affect the insulation properties of window panes.

Avoiding extreme temperature changes and maintaining your windows will help you avoid this issue. It's important to deal with the issue immediately when it happens.

Repair of the Seal

Misty double glazing repairs are a common problem for those who have double-glazed windows. The double-glazed windows have an airtight seal that is between two panes. This assists in controlling the temperature of a building or room. When these seals become damaged, it could cause problems like draughts, condensation, and loss of energy. These issues can be expensive to fix if left untreated. Fortunately, there are ways to fix this issue without having to replace the entire double-glazed unit.

Hot Melt Sealant is the primary component that holds the two glass panes together in a double-glazed unit. This sealant can keep two glass panes in place, but will only last for a short period before it wears down or is damaged. When the Hot-Melt Sealant breaks down, water will begin to build up between the panes of glass in the window, which causes it to turn misty.

One of the main reasons is when windows with double glazing are used to dry clothes or when it's used to cool down an office space. These activities can lead to condensation building up on the inside of the window. This can lead to fogging. A sudden temperature change could also cause this. This could cause the window to develop a leak or crack that will allow moisture into the insulation.

The most popular method to fix a double-glazed window is by replacing the glass unit. This is a cheaper alternative than replacing the entire window, and it can be accomplished quickly by skilled installers for as little as PS50. It's also an excellent opportunity to upgrade to energy-efficient glass that is A-rated to further cut down on your heating costs.

Most double glazing is filled with air between the panes. Sometimes Argon gas is used to provide additional insulation. This is secured by Hot-Melt sealants. If this sealant begins to fail (perhaps due to a defect in the manufacturing process or installation error) then moisture can begin to build up between the panes, giving an appearance of mist.

Some companies claim they can repair windows that have been damaged without having to replace them. They do this by drilling into the window and then using chemicals to soak out the moisture. This is a messy procedure and is difficult to accomplish with toughened glass. It is not a permanent fix and windows are likely to get misty again.
